The good thing about it is I seem to rebound pretty quickly. This afternoon I tried to run before the rain hit. I had a nice start, but a half mile into my run I stepped on a rock and felt a the sharp pain of my ankle rolling. Fortunately nothing snapped, but I did give my ankle a good pull. I hobbled to the corner and realized my run was over. I was really bummed because it looked like I was going to beat that rain and I wanted to get a run in today especially with the coming cold weather.<\/p>\n<p>So I headed back to the house feeling kind of irritated with myself. As I rounded the corner past the park I noticed my ankle felt a lot better. I think the cold air on my bare ankles (still wearing my summer ankle socks) kept the swelling down. I tested out a short run and just kept going. Back through the park and on with the original 5 mile route. I kept my pace down and concentrated on my foot strike. I didn&#8217;t feel any pain until I went up a particularly long steep uphill and I could really feel the lack of strength in the offending ankle. <\/p>\n<p>I am of course doing the best  for it RICE &#8211; rest, ice, compression, elevation. I also took three acetaminophen and strapped on my ankle brace. I also rubbed in some arnica gel which I have been using as a liniment. I doubt it will have any effect, maybe some pain relief. I have been able to walk on it but I am moving slowly.
